Dear package maintainer, This is an automated bug created due to the announced change proposal Disablement of STI tests. Your project still has STI tests under `tests/tests*.yml`, which will no longer be run soon. We suggest you migrate these tests to TMT format instead. In the simplest case when the STI tests is a simple wrapper around a `tests/run_tests.sh`, the migration would look like this: ``` $ tmt init $ rm tests/tests.yml $ cat <<EOF > ./plans.fmf summary: Run all smoke tests discover: how: fmf execute: how: tmt EOF $ cat <<EOF > ./tests/main.fmf summary: Smoke test test: ./run_tests.sh EOF ``` See https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Changes/DisableSTI for more information, including a link to a migration guide.
